About Jia Gu
Jia Gu is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Molecular Biology, Biomedical Engineering, Epidemiology and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 42 papers that have together received 17.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(10 papers), Image and Signal Denoising Methods (5 papers), COVID-19 epidemiological studies (3 papers), Cancer Genomics and Diagnostics (3 papers), Surgical Simulation and Training (2 papers), Cervical Cancer and HPV Research (2 papers), Advanced Image Processing Techniques (2 papers) and Advanced Neural Network Applications (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(7.4k citations), Ecology (2.7k citations), Plant Science (3.8k citations), Endocrinology (505 citations) and Molecular Medicine (414 citations). Jia Gu has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Hong Kong. Frequent co-authors include Shifu Chen, Yanqing Zhou, Yaru Chen, Tanxiao Huang, Mingyan Xu, Yue Han, Tiexiang Wen, Wenjian Qin, Yaoqin Xie and Zhicheng Li. Their work appears in journals such as BioMedical Engineering OnLine, BMC Bioinformatics, Ultrasonic Imaging, Journal of Clinical Oncology and Frontiers in Cellular and Infection Microbiology.
